Output 6c8771613c6ee5ea78d81ab95a718891bd84ce522e5a90c841bc8a0e311ae268:0

value
481866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4f3f4fe9520a39ad82ab296922cff09e29a1258 OP_EQUAL
address
3JBooW9kiAzSCiWW9rM3qVB3frZrrxb83C
transaction
6c8771613c6ee5ea78d81ab95a718891bd84ce522e5a90c841bc8a0e311ae268
spent
true